Which group was never allowed in the Georgia colony?

Jews
Catholics
Salzburgers
Malcontents

Answer:

Catholics

Step-by-step explanation:

Catholics were never allowed in the Georgia colony. The colony was founded in 1732 by James Oglethorpe with the goal of providing a haven for persecuted Protestants. Catholics were not welcome in the colony because they were seen as a threat to the Protestant faith.
